** The home security market for Billingsley, Alabama, is characteristic of a rural/small-town area. There are no major security companies physically headquartered within the town limits itself. Consequently, the market is served by providers from nearby larger cities, primarily Montgomery and Prattville. The competition is moderate, with a few strong regional players and the ubiquitous presence of national giants like ADT and Vivint through their dealer networks. The average quality of service is good, with providers offering modern technology such as cellular monitoring, HD video surveillance, and smart home automation. Typical pricing is competitive with national averages. Residents can expect initial installation costs to range from $0 (with a contract) to $1,500+ for advanced, custom systems. Monthly monitoring fees generally fall between $30 and $60, depending on the level of service, video storage, and smart features included. The local companies often compete on personalized service and maintenance, while the national brands leverage their extensive monitoring infrastructure and brand trust.

In the Billingsley area, a basic professionally installed system typically starts between $200-$600 for equipment and installation, with monthly monitoring fees ranging from $30 to $60. Local factors include the need for systems resilient to Alabama's high humidity and occasional severe storms, which can add to equipment costs. Additionally, properties on larger rural lots may require longer wireless ranges or cellular backup, which can influence the final price.
For a standard home in Billingsley, professional installation of a comprehensive security system typically takes 3 to 6 hours. The technician will assess your home's layout, discuss optimal sensor placement (considering local construction styles common in Autauga County), and test all components. They will also ensure the system is configured for reliable operation, which is crucial given the potential for cellular service fluctuations in more rural parts of the area.
Yes, seasonal patterns are important. During hunting season and the summer months, there can be increased transient activity near rural properties. Furthermore, Alabama's severe storm season (spring and fall) heightens the risk of power outages, making a system with battery and cellular backup critical. It's also wise to consider security lighting and cameras to monitor long driveways or outbuildings common in the area.
For Billingsley residents, a local or regional provider often has a better understanding of the specific challenges of rural and semi-rural Autauga County living, such as response protocols with the Autauga County Sheriff's Office. They may offer more personalized service and faster local technician dispatch. Always verify that any provider, local or national, is licensed by the Alabama Electronic Security Board of Licensure (AESBL) to ensure they meet state standards.
While self-monitored camera systems offer a good visual deterrent, a professionally monitored alarm system is highly recommended for Billingsley due to longer emergency response times from county deputies. Monitored systems provide 24/7 dispatch to fire, medical, and police services even if you're unavailable, which is vital during storms or if you're away from home. A hybrid approach using monitored sensors with self-view cameras is a popular and effective solution for comprehensive local security.
